Cattle roam freely around KwaThema

Vlakfontein - Residents are concerned that roaming livestock near Vlakfontein Road may pose a danger to motorists.

The animals are regularly found near the road and it is feared they will obstruct traffic or cause accidents.

KwaThema resident Philip Ngwenya (69) says the cows and goats are owned by people from the KwaThema Hostel who allow them to roam freely without a herder.

Ngwenya believes no one will steal them due to the community being in ‘fear’ of witchcraft.

It is alleged the animals are protected by witchcraft and should anyone attempt to steal them, they will be bewitched.

He believes the roaming animals will chase investors away from the township.

“They will see the township as more rural than it really is,” he says.

“I do not condemn subsistence farming, but I also don’t condone the cattle roaming around the township.”

Ward 77 councillor Wilson Busakwe says he can not comment on the matter due to the by-laws. He did not explain further.

The Ekurhuleni Metro had not responded by the time the article went to print.
